The Birth of a Streetwear Legend

The story of Stussy begins in the early 1980s with Shawn Stussy, a surfboard shaper from Laguna Beach. He used to sign his boards with a bold, hand-drawn logo that looked more like street graffiti than a traditional brand mark. This signature soon found its way onto T-shirts, caps, and sweatshirts, creating an identity that felt raw, rebellious, and different.

At a time when fashion was dominated by clean, polished looks, Stussy offered something fresh. It combined surf culture with the energy of skateboarding, punk, and emerging hip-hop scenes. This unique mix made the brand instantly appealing to young people who wanted clothing that reflected their lifestyle and attitude.


From Local Label to Global Movement

What started as a small local project quickly turned into an international phenomenon. By the late 1980s and early 1990s, Stussy had gained popularity far beyond California. The brand opened stores in major cities such as New York, Tokyo, London, and Paris, each becoming a hub for street culture.

Stussy also created the “International Stussy Tribe,” a collective of DJs, artists, skaters, and creatives who represented the brand in their own cities. This network helped spread Stussy’s influence worldwide and built a strong community around the brand. Wearing Stussy was no longer just about fashion; it was about belonging to a global culture.

Influence on Music and Youth Culture

Stussy’s rise is closely linked to its connection with music and youth movements. In the 1990s and 2000s, the brand became a staple in hip-hop and underground scenes. Rappers, DJs, and producers wore Stussy both on and off stage, giving it authenticity and cultural credibility.

This relationship with music helped shape Stussy’s image as a brand that truly understands street life. The pull stussy hoodie, often seen in music videos and concerts, became a visual symbol of urban identity.
